The Salem Township Hospital will host a Diabetes Support & Nutrition Education Group meeting on Thursday, September 25, from 2:00 pm to 3:00 pm. The event will take place in the Linda Mobley Community Room at the hospital’s location, 1201 Ricker Drive, Salem, Illinois.

The session is titled “Exercising with Diabetes: Activity for Every Ability.” Topics to be discussed include the importance of exercise in diabetes management, best practices for fueling the body to promote muscle gain and healthy recovery, types of exercise suitable for different fitness levels, indoor exercise options during colder months, and stretches and tips for moving safely.

Light snacks designed to be diabetes-friendly will be available. According to organizers, “Group meetings are free and open to all ages.”
